    Abstract: The present subject matter relates to an electro-mechanical actuation control system and a method to control the electro-mechanical actuation control system thereof for controlling the speed of the vehicle. The electro-mechanical actuation control system (200) for the vehicle (100) includes a controller module (202) configured to enable speed control of said vehicle (100), said controller module (202) includes one or more vehicle component controller (202b). A transmitter (203) configured to transmit input signals as generated by said controller module. A receiver (205) configured to receive transmitted input signals from said transmitter (203). An actuator driver (207) configured to receive inputs from said receiver (205), said actuator driver (207) is mounted on said vehicle (100). One or more vehicle components (209) connected to said actuator (208).

    Abstract: The present subject matter relates to a two-wheeled vehicle. More particularly but not exclusively, to a balancing system for balancing the vehicle using only two or three wheels. The saddle-type vehicle (100) comprising a head tube (106), a first frame member (107) extending obliquely rearwardly from said head tube (106) along a vehicle longitudinal axis (MN), one or more second frame members (108) extending rearwardly upwardly from said first frame member (107) along said vehicle longitudinal axis (MN), a central frame (111) and a support structure (201) extending downwardly from said central frame member (111), a balancing system (202) for enabling stabilization of said vehicle (100), said balancing system (202) is being supported by said support structure (201).
